Subject: Role-based access on the Fernwick wiki

Hi folks — quick heads-up before review: we've split the Fernwick wiki into reader, editor, and steward roles, enforced at the page-tree level. Your integration should request editor scope only. When testing against our staging wiki, authenticate your calls with the bearer token below.

login token, bagug-kafop: eyJhbGciOiJIUzI1NiIsInR5cCI6IkpXVCJ9.eyJzdWIiOiIcMLov2In0.Z5RLDIfp

## Step 4: Pagination cutover

Quill API v3 replaces offset pagination with cursor tokens. Old `page` params return 410 after the freeze. Release manager: confirm gateway rewrite rules are live before tagging. Clients on v2 get a deprecation header for two sprints. The cursor service reads the following settings at boot.

settings of yaguf-fajof:
[druvan]
host = druvan.plorvatech.example
user = druvan_svc
database = druvan_prod

## Approvals: Legacy ORM Refactor (Project Tarnwell)

All changes touching the old `quarry-orm` layer require two approvals: one from the data platform group, one from the migration lead. Schema-affecting diffs additionally need a dry-run report attached. Do not approve anything that bypasses the compatibility shim — we still have three services on the legacy mapper. Reviewers: escalate disputes instead of merging. Final sign-off authority for this refactor rests with the following person.

approver of yawig-yajef = Briius Jorix